diff options
Diffstat (limited to 'libraries/re2')
-rw-r--r-- | libraries/re2/do-not-find-googletest-and-benchmark.patch | 4 | ||||
-rw-r--r-- | libraries/re2/re2.SlackBuild | 6 | ||||
-rw-r--r-- | libraries/re2/re2.info | 6 |
3 files changed, 8 insertions, 8 deletions
diff --git a/libraries/re2/do-not-find-googletest-and-benchmark.patch b/libraries/re2/do-not-find-googletest-and-benchmark.patch index 4f7eecbfcd..4beeb0b3c5 100644 --- a/libraries/re2/do-not-find-googletest-and-benchmark.patch +++ b/libraries/re2/do-not-find-googletest-and-benchmark.patch @@ -18,9 +18,9 @@ CXXFLAGS?=-O3 -g LDFLAGS?= # required --RE2_CXXFLAGS?=-pthread -Wall -Wextra -Wno-unused-parameter -Wno-missing-field-initializers -I. $(CCABSL) $(CCICU) $(CCGTEST) $(CCBENCHMARK) $(CCPCRE) +-RE2_CXXFLAGS?=-std=c++17 -pthread -Wall -Wextra -Wno-unused-parameter -Wno-missing-field-initializers -I. $(CCABSL) $(CCICU) $(CCGTEST) $(CCBENCHMARK) $(CCPCRE) -RE2_LDFLAGS?=-pthread $(LDABSL) $(LDICU) $(LDGTEST) $(LDBENCHMARK) $(LDPCRE) -+RE2_CXXFLAGS?=-pthread -Wall -Wextra -Wno-unused-parameter -Wno-missing-field-initializers -I. $(CCABSL) $(CCICU) $(CCPCRE) ++RE2_CXXFLAGS?=-std=c++17 -pthread -Wall -Wextra -Wno-unused-parameter -Wno-missing-field-initializers -I. $(CCABSL) $(CCICU) $(CCPCRE) +RE2_LDFLAGS?=-pthread $(LDABSL) $(LDICU) $(LDPCRE) AR?=ar ARFLAGS?=rsc diff --git a/libraries/re2/re2.SlackBuild b/libraries/re2/re2.SlackBuild index 1b17c9c8d8..05e3a6a261 100644 --- a/libraries/re2/re2.SlackBuild +++ b/libraries/re2/re2.SlackBuild @@ -3,7 +3,7 @@ # Slackware build script for re2 # Copyright 2018-2020 Larry Hajali <larryhaja[at]gmail[dot]com> -# Copyright 2024 Isaac Yu <isaacyu@protonmail.com> +# Copyright 2024-2025 Isaac Yu <isaacyu@protonmail.com> # All rights reserved. # # Redistribution and use of this script, with or without modification, is @@ -26,7 +26,7 @@ cd $(dirname $0) ; CWD=$(pwd) PRGNAM=re2 -VERSION=${VERSION:-2024_07_02} +VERSION=${VERSION:-2025_08_12} PKGVER=$(echo $VERSION | tr _ -) BUILD=${BUILD:-1} TAG=${TAG:-_SBo} @@ -96,7 +96,7 @@ find $PKG -print0 | xargs -0 file | grep -e "executable" -e "shared object" | gr rm -f $PKG/usr/lib${LIBDIRSUFFIX}/*.a mkdir -p $PKG/usr/doc/$PRGNAM-$VERSION -cp -a CONTRIBUTING.md LICENSE README SECURITY.md $PKG/usr/doc/$PRGNAM-$VERSION +cp -a CONTRIBUTING.md LICENSE README.md SECURITY.md $PKG/usr/doc/$PRGNAM-$VERSION cat $CWD/$PRGNAM.SlackBuild > $PKG/usr/doc/$PRGNAM-$VERSION/$PRGNAM.SlackBuild mkdir -p $PKG/install diff --git a/libraries/re2/re2.info b/libraries/re2/re2.info index db34f91586..23dc58a3ac 100644 --- a/libraries/re2/re2.info +++ b/libraries/re2/re2.info @@ -1,8 +1,8 @@ PRGNAM="re2" -VERSION="2024_07_02" +VERSION="2025_08_12" HOMEPAGE="https://github.com/google/re2" -DOWNLOAD="https://github.com/google/re2/archive/2024-07-02/re2-2024-07-02.tar.gz" -MD5SUM="73c94c78678bd2d641beaf8d5a3fd352" +DOWNLOAD="https://github.com/google/re2/archive/2025-08-12/re2-2025-08-12.tar.gz" +MD5SUM="42b09a49841249c5ff004df5f2ed6202" DOWNLOAD_x86_64="" MD5SUM_x86_64="" REQUIRES="abseil-cpp" |